https://collections.mcny.org/Collection/Afternoon ensemble comprising coat, blouse and skirt in wool mohair boucle-2F3XC5NS42NA.html Larger image76.108.2A-CCoco Chanel (1883-1971)Afternoon ensemble comprising coat, blouse and skirt in wool mohair boucleDate:1960-1969A: Wool, mohair boucle coat in white, dark grey, grey, and brown large houndstooth check; straight; single-breasted; knee-length; white mink collar and cuffs; long straight sleeves; slit pocket at each hip; antiqued gold metal lion motif round buttons - eight down front, five on each sleeve; quilted ivory slubbed silk lining; interior hem edged with gold braid piping. B: Off-white slubbed wool basketweave blouse; straight; hip-length; collarless, small V-notch at neck; sleeveless; V-flange from shoulders to navel with gold lion button at point; two rows of gold metal chain, around waist and 2 inches below; back zipper; silk lining. C: Off-white slubbed wool basketweave skirt; straight; above-knee length; waistband at natural waist; V-flange from waist tapering to hem; proper left side zipper closure; silk lining. Label, A: Chanel.
